      Considering this, how do you rotate text<\/strong> in InDesign<\/strong>? In InDesign you draw the text frame and you have to rotate the frame the direction that you need it to be in. It couldn’t be simpler to do either, draw a text frame then rotate it using the Rotate Tool or using the Rotate button on the Control Panel at the top of the screen.<\/p>\n
